Traffic Safety Requirements in Grainger County
traffic safety requirements in Grainger County vary based on the type of court proceeding. Municipal courts in Blaine may order shorter programs (4-12 hours), while district and superior courts in Tennessee often mandate 16-52 hours for more serious cases. Our program accommodates all standard hour requirements.
Common scenarios where Blaine residents may need a traffic safety class include court orders following a traffic violation, probation conditions set during sentencing, point reduction to maintain driving privileges, and insurance requirements to qualify for premium discounts.
